St. Augustine Alligator Farm hosting 4th annual Raptor Run for conservation

ST. AUGUSTINE, Fla. — This Sunday, the St. Augustine Alligator Farm invites runners to participate in its annual 3k Raptor Run for Florida wildlife conservation.

According to the website, all proceeds from the all-ages run goes to a conservation organization to aid in the protection and research of native wildlife. This year, the run is raising funds for the Orianne Center for Indigo Snake Conservation and AZA Saving Animals from Extinction.

All participants will receive a Raptor Run 3k t-shirt, a finisher’s medal, post-race refreshments and a free child’s admission ticket to the Alligator Farm for every adult ticket purchased.

The race is at 8 a.m. on March 5 at the Alligator Farm, located at 999 Anastasia Blvd. St. Augustine, Florida.
